Metal Roofing in London, Ontario: Install It Once

London homeowners are asking about metal roofs more every year, partly because of winter. A smooth metal surface sheds snow and does not build the ice dams that damage shingle roofs along the eaves.

The main choices are standing seam (concealed fasteners, clean vertical lines) and metal shingles that mimic slate or shake. Both use steel or aluminum with a baked-on finish over a solid deck and high-temperature underlayment.

Metal costs more up front and is quoted in writing after an inspection, with the panel system, gauge, trim and snow guards all listed.

How It Works

Your Roof, Done in 4 Steps

From the first call to the final walkthrough, here is what happens and when.

System and Profile Selection

Standing seam or metal shingle, steel or aluminum, colour and gauge, chosen at the inspection with samples in hand.

Deck Prep and Underlayment

Existing roof removed where required, deck checked, then high-temperature synthetic underlayment and ice and water shield installed.

Panel Fabrication and Install

Panels are cut to length for each run, seamed or interlocked, and fastened with concealed clips and colour-matched trim.

Flashings, Snow Guards and Sign-Off

Ridge cap, valley and wall flashings finished, snow guards fitted above entries, site cleaned and the roof walked through with you.

Metal Roofing —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a metal roof cost in London, Ontario?
Published 2026 Ontario ranges put installed metal roofing at roughly $10 to $16 per square foot for panel systems and $14 to $22 for standing seam, so a metal roof on a typical London home often lands between $25,000 and $50,000. That is two to three times an asphalt roof up front, spread over a much longer life.
Can a metal roof go over existing shingles?
Sometimes, if there is a single layer in good condition and the deck is sound. It is decided at inspection; where the old roof is failing or layered, a tear-off is the better base and is quoted as such.
Is a metal roof noisy in the rain?
Not noticeably on a house. With a solid deck, underlayment and attic insulation between the panels and the living space, rain on a metal roof sounds much like rain on shingles.
How long does a metal roof last in Ontario's climate?
Steel and aluminum roofs are typically rated for 40 to 70 years. Painted finishes are made to resist fading and chalking for decades, and the freeze-thaw cycles that wear out shingles do little to metal.
Will a metal roof work with solar panels later?
Yes, and standing seam is the easiest roof to add panels to, because clamps attach to the seams without any roof penetrations.
